## Deploying the Gatewick Proctor Queue

Deploys are pretty painless: push to main, wait for the pipeline, then watch the queue drain dashboard for five minutes. If candidates pile up mid-exam, roll back first and ask questions later — the queue replays safely. Everything the workers care about lives in one config block, shown here for reference.

settings of bafof-yagef:
JOROX_PIN=8740
JOROX_TENANT=pelox
JOROX_METRICS_HOST=metrics.jorox.qorvelworks.internal
JOROX_SEAL=seal_c78f63c1
JOROX_STANDBY_TEAM=norax

**Vendor note: Inkmill markdown pipeline**

Rendering for Parchway docs is outsourced to Inkmill under an annual contract, renewing each March. They handle sanitization and PDF export; we own the upload queue. SLA: 4-hour response on rendering failures. Escalate only after two failed retries. Their support desk is reachable at the address below.

billing contact of hahaf-baguf = zorael.tammir.jorius@sivrelhq.internal

To the release manager: I'm passing ownership of the Pellwick deep-link router to Sorrel before the 4.2 cut. The intent-matching table now lives in the Farrowgate config service; stale entries were purged last sprint. Watch the fallback route — it silently swallows malformed slugs, which inflated our drop-off metrics in March. The staging resolver needs its keystore unlocked before each regression pass, and that keystore accepts only one credential. For the signing vault, the recovery phrase is noted directly below.

recovery phrase for tafog-fafog: novix-novdor-fraath-brieth-olieth-oliix-rusix-wenion-julax-druox

Ticket: Archiver skips empty cold storage buckets (Glacierbin). Steps to reproduce: 1) Create a bucket in the Norvale sandbox with zero objects. 2) Run the nightly archive job manually. 3) Observe the bucket is marked archived but no manifest is written. Expected: manifest written regardless. To run the job, authenticate with the token below.

login token, kagaf-bawig: eyJhbGciOiJIUzI1NiIsInR5cCI6IkpXVCJ9.eyJzdWIiOiI1b8bmcIn0.xjc0uBP3